About Temple, TX

Maintaining the title of being the demographic center of Texas, within three hours of Dallas, Houston and San Antonio and only one hour from Austin, Temple offers the conveniences of a big city with the atmosphere of a small town. Situated on two of the most beautiful lakes in the Texas Hill Country, Temple provides its residents with a growing and vibrant economy, affordable homes and an outstanding public and private school system.

About Round Rock, TX

Round Rock offers a wonderful school district and great city parks to its residents. The Round Rock Independent School District has been named one of the nation’s top school districts, with multiple campuses that are named national Blue Ribbon schools year after year. The Round Rock Express, a Triple-A minor league baseball team owned by Nolan Ryan and the farm team for the Texas Rangers, also calls Round Rock home, playing at the Dell Diamond – one of the finest minor league stadiums in the nation.

The city of Round Rock boasts a population of around 110,000, but retains a small town feel. Most residents report feeling extremely safe walking the streets at night. The crime rate is low. It has received awards for its astounding city planning. Its cost of living is also one of the lowest in the area, with low utility rates and property taxes.
